Output 3bba4f810dc276314bf4086ef5662d79de5dfb380c05ddbfd4a1e3212b7c7508:0

value
337757
script pubkey
OP_0 OP_PUSHBYTES_20 ef5fcd8ff1b42675486c522e239a6638f342c659
address
bc1qaa0umrl3ksn82jrv2ghz8xnx8re593jewnuk85
transaction
3bba4f810dc276314bf4086ef5662d79de5dfb380c05ddbfd4a1e3212b7c7508